Congratulations to those who completed this one.
For anyone still struggling, here's the solution. Highlight to read.
1. Get Loof up to blue sphere. Push sphere D, L U, L. Z-bot is diverted and blows up the barrel and 2 steel boxes, leaving barrels 1 and 2. Push blue sphere up onto green button. Collect coins.
2. Push barrel 1 down to position 1. That way the kaboom will only blow up one steel box (marked red X). Push steel box A onto yellow button A. Push steel box B onto blue button B.
3. Get barrel 2 to position 2. The next kaboom will only blow up the second steel box marked red X. Now you have 5 steel boxes to use in the top right corner to fill lava and cover red button. Collect coins.
4. For a shortcut push the wooden box into the water so you can avoid crossing the electro-tiles sometimes.
5. Push the bottom green sphere into the water. This restarts the generator. Alternately push spheres from either side of the generator, collecting coins.
6. Finally you have an L shaped bridge and one sphere left of the generator, which you push up onto the light blue button.
7. Exit.

Played this totally different

and maybe a bit hazardous
The blue sphere part I did like recommended. But then I put the first barrel on the yellow 1 (actually there is an electro tile, so you need precise timing) to blow up Kaboom and box no. 1. Then I build the bridge with the green spheres. Now I had to time the pushing of the last sphere that it blows up the Kaboom and box no. 2.
Now one box goes to the dark blue button, 5 boxes go to the red button, one stays on a yellow button. Made a bridge to the island with barrel and wooden box. Metal box from yellow button to light blue button and exit.
